> > Not sure what's in use, but here's what they would use:
> > 172.375 FN
> > 170.000 Air/Gnd
> > 168.050 TAC1
> > 168.200 TAC2
> > 168.600 TAC3
> > 173.9125 TAC4
> > 173.9625 TAC5
> > 173.9875 TAC6
> > 168.700 CMD1
> > 168.100 CMD2
> > 168.075 CMD3
> > 166.6125 CMD4
> > 169.750 CMD5
> > (CMD6 FREQS UNUSABLE-173.8125,USED BY LA FBI,167.100 BY TREASURY IAD)
> > 166.675 AT1
> > 169.150 AT2
> > 169.200 AT3
> > 167.950 AT7
> > 118.95
> > 119.975
> > 122.925
> > 122.975
> > 123.075 HELO'S
> > 130.2 (NEW REPORTED)
> > 131.475 (SAME)

I forgot logistics:
414.650 R CH1
415.400 R CH2 (On which I heard AIRCRAFT, which is very wierd...)
415.500 R CH3
Also USFS and BLM combined Commands & tacs, so I've heard BLM tacs show up 
on fires out here:
168.250
168.275 (heard on an Angeles fire)
166.725 R
166.775
